摘要
For the comprehensive assessment of congenital vascular malformations we use the combination of colour coded duplex sonography (CCDS), laser Doppler perfusion imaging (LDPI) and infrared thermography (IT) to get some evidence about the depth, perfusion and vascularity of the lesion. IT gives hints on low blood flow areas and indicates arterial-venous shunts. CCDS is the most important tool to describe the different types (arterial, venous, lymphatic) and combined forms of malformations. LDPI is a helpful method to get an impression of the superficial capillary part of vascular lesions. The combination of all imaging methods allows a complete assessment not only for describing a lesion but also in the monitoring of reducing pathologic vessels under laser treatment.
